Lunaz Resumes Operations with Beckham Backing
Lunaz, the David Beckham-backed firm converting classic cars to electric, is back in action.
Located within Northamptonshire’s Silverstone Park, production ceased at the facility in March due to delays in the ban on the sale of petrol and diesel vehicles from 2030 to 2035.
The firm said it had a:
“new structure that lays the foundations for the long-term sustainable growth of the business”.
Founded in 2019 by David Lorenz, it initially focused on converting classic cars to electric power but later expanded its program to include industrial vehicles and trucks. Beckham invested in the firm and commissioned it to convert one of his cars.
The conversion of commercial vehicles will continue under the Up-cycled Electric Vehicles brand, with trials of the first products scheduled for this summer. The company added that the initial trials would involve the world’s first fully up-cycled and electrified 26-tonne commercial trucks, which will operate as refuse collection vehicles.
Founder and CEO, David Lorenz, said;
“We are delighted to have worked with our clients and stakeholders to create a new structure that lays the foundations for the long-term sustainable growth of the business.
“This ensures we are ready to meet immediate demand for vehicle electrification services and are fit to scale in direct response to volume requirements as major markets build towards legislative bans on internal combustion engine commercial vehicles.”
